Section 61-5-69 - Priority of contribution claims in bankruptcy proceedings

Ask AI about this
61-5-69. Priority of contribution claims in bankruptcy proceedings.In the event of an employer's adjudication in bankruptcy, judicially confirmed extension proposal, or composition, under federal bankruptcy law, contributions due are entitled to such priority as is provided in federal bankruptcy law. Source: SL 1936 (SS), ch 3, §14 (c); SDC 1939, §17.0826; SL 1961, ch 107, §3; SL 2008, ch 277, §105; SDCL §61-5-50; SL 2012, ch 252, §59.
